GM Financial is the captive finance company and the wholly owned subsidiary of General Motors and is headquartered in Fort Worth, Texas. The company is a global provider of auto finance solutions, with operations in North America, Latin America and China. Through our long-standing relationships with auto dealers, we offer attractive retail loan and lease programs to meet the needs of each customer. We also offer commercial lending products to dealers to help them finance and grow their businesses.
